People in Venezuela have commemorated the death of a prominent general who died while conducting operations against ISIS in eastern Syria last week.
Brigadier General Issam Zahreddin died last week on Saqr Island near Deir Ezzor city when his convoy was hit by a landmine planted by the terrorist organisation, killing the famous general.
He was buried in his home region of Sweida on Friday to the great sadness of the Syrian people who became inspired by his leadership as he fought ISIS on the front line with his soldiers. He prevented the downfall of Deir Ezzor as it underwent a near 3-year siege from ISIS, which was only broken last month.

Venezuela has been one of the very few states that has maintained cordial relations with Syria.
Syrian President Bashar al-Assad was close friends with the late Venezuealan leader Hugo Chavez.
